Post by rincon Sat Feb 11, 2017 11:10 am

Mertens was a bench player because he was never a better winger than Insigne. Every time Mertens gave a top performance from the bench people wanted him to start, then he did for a while and showed that his best games were always against a tired defense.

His game is not very complete, he can't pass the ball around and create opportunities patiently as well Insigne and Callejon.

When he gets the ball he always tries to find a shot/final ball by running straight at the defense and trying to dribble through. It works better with space when he was coming off the bench, or now playing in the center. He receives the ball closer to goal and just has to beat 1 man before shooting or creating a real chance.

If Milik finds form again and retakes the CF role (not a given) then Mertens will eventually go back to bench instead of benching Insigne at LW.

Mertens is banging in the goals but he hasn't been Napoli's best player over the whole season. He just shines the most over a quick look because of the stats.
